SBI Clerk 2022 mains cut off for all the categories is given below.
| States/UTs | General | OBC | ST | SC | EWS |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Uttarakhand | 83 | 69.75 | 56 | 60.25 | 72 |
| Andaman & Nicobar Islands | |||||
| Andhra Pradesh | |||||
| Arunachal Pradesh | |||||
| Assam | 72 | ||||
| Bihar | |||||
| Chhattisgarh | 77.25 | 75.75 | |||
| Delhi | |||||
| Goa | 70 | ||||
| Gujarat | 74.5 | 67.25 | 50 | 62.75 | 70 |
| Haryana | 85.5 | ||||
| Himachal Pradesh | 85.75 | ||||
| Jammu & Kashmir | 77 | ||||
| Jharkhand | |||||
| Karnataka | 70.75 | 67 | |||
| Kerala | |||||
| Madhya Pradesh | 78.25 | 72.25 | |||
| Maharashtra | 76 | 70.25 | 52.25 | 68.5 | 70 |
| Manipur | 70 | ||||
| Meghalaya | |||||
| Mizoram | |||||
| Nagaland | |||||
| Odisha | 78.75 | ||||
| Puducherry | 72 | ||||
| Punjab | 84.25 | ||||
| Rajasthan | 80.5 | 75 | |||
| Tamil Nadu | 78 | 75.5 | |||
| Telangana | 78.25 | 74 | |||
| Tripura | |||||
| Uttar Pradesh | 82.75 | 73.5 | 77 | ||
| West Bengal | 80.5 | 68 |

Yes! for appearing in IBPS or any banking exams you should just possess Graduation degree from any stream. So, don't keep any doubt and start best preparation towards all banking exams as most of the syllabus are same in all Banking exam.
Banking exams need minimum qualification which is graduation in any stream.

The preliminary result for SBI Clerk 2024 was revealed on February 15, 2024. The findings were announced on the SBI's official website.
To verify the findings, contestants had to:
Visit the SBI Clerk career page at sbi.co.in/web/careers.
Log in using the needed credentials, such as the registration number, roll number, and date of birth.
Enter the captcha code and click the "Submit" button.
The results show the candidates' qualifying marks for the next round of selection procedure. In addition to the results, the scorecard is released.
